Malaysian Online Shoppers To Increase, Says Reblex Business Group

By Nor Awaina Arbee Ahmad Rejal Arbee KUALA LUMPUR, May 27 (Bernama) -- Reblex Business Group Sdn Bhd, an organiser of business conferences, sees the number of Malaysian online shoppers increasing over the next five years. President Felex Tan said online shoppers are expected to make up 50 per cent of the population within this period. "Currently, only 30 per cent of the population shops online, with the likelihood of retail shoppers being transformed to the former in time. "On some sites, it is safe to say that business is booming as the number of shoppers grows," he told Bernama after launching the 5th Asia E-commerce Conference 2015 here, Wednesday. He said the online industry is also growing steadily in Malaysia and Southeast Asia. Meanwhile, Tan explained that the 5th Asia E-commerce Conference 2015 is being organised by Reblex to provide a platform for companies to network in the e-commerce industry. "Our first conference in 2011 had only 30 delegates. This time, we have seen a big leap to 300. "This conference also gives us an opportunity to encourage shoppers and companies to venture into the e-commerce market," he said. Tan said the one-day conference has invited international players giving talks as well as providing business networking opportunities for delegates. -- BERNAMA
